Ensuring Safety and Security in a School District

Comprehensive Security Plan

  • Establish a district-wide security plan with input from law enforcement, school administrators, staff, students, and the community.
  • Outline clear protocols for emergency situations, lockdown procedures, and threat management.
  • Conduct regular security audits and drills to test and refine plans.

Physical Security Measures

  • Install and maintain secure entrances and surveillance cameras.
  • Implement visitor screening and identification systems.
  • Provide adequate lighting and secure perimeter fencing.
  • Establish partnerships with local law enforcement for patrols and response.

Staff Training and Awareness

  • Provide comprehensive security training for all staff, including teachers, administrators, and support personnel.
  • Train staff on recognizing and responding to suspicious behavior or potential threats.
  • Conduct drills and simulations to foster staff familiarity with emergency procedures.

Student Engagement and Education

  • Involve students in safety planning and drills to empower them as partners in security.
  • Educate students about the importance of safety and reporting suspicious behavior.
  • Foster a school climate where students feel safe and respected.
